Visit the World War II Valor in the Pacific National Monument at Pearl Harbor to reflect, remember and understand the tragic events of December 7, 1941.  You will also learn more about the people involved and the events that led up to and followed the attack on the Pacific Fleet.  Guests can visit any attraction that they would like while at Pearl Harbor a la carte. 

Tickets to the Arizona Memorial are available via recreation.gov and are released precisely 8 weeks and then again 1 day before the tour and must get booked in advance. Guests have the option to visit any of the other great attractions at the National Park a la carte. The Battleship Missouri and Pearl Harbor Aviation Museum are located on Ford Island, while the Bowfin Submarine offers easy access from the Visitor Center.

Pearl Harbor National Memorial
Guests can visit Pearl Harbor and explore any attractions at the Memorial a la carte. Tickets to the USS Arizona Memorial must be reserved via recreation.gov in advance. They release tickets 8 weeks prior and then again 1 day prior to the tour date at exactly 3 pm Hawaii Standard Time.
2
USS Arizona Memorial
Guests can visit the Arizona Memorial, this ship suffered the most casualties during the attack and is the most popular attraction at Pearl Harbor. Tickets to the USS Arizona Memorial must be reserved via recreation.gov in advance. They release tickets 8 weeks prior and then again 1 day prior to the tour date at exactly 3 pm Hawaii Standard Time.
3
Battleship Missouri Memorial
Guests have the option of visiting the Battleship Missouri while at Pearl Harbor. This ship is where the treaty was signed to end World War II in the Pacific. Tour includes 35 minute guided tour by ship experts. Guests can spend as much time as they want at the Battleship, the timeline is an average time including transportation to and from Ford Island.
4
Pearl Harbor Aviation Museum
Guests have the option to see military aircraft from World War II and beyond, guests can even ride the realistic flight simulator and all admission includes an audio set tour. Guests can spend as much time as they want at the Aviation Museum, the timeline is an average time including transportation to and from Ford Island.
5
USS Bowfin Submarine Museum & Park
Guests have the option to see what life was like for those stationed on the “Pearl Harbor Avenger” while at the Memorial. All admissions come with an audio set tour of the submarine. Guests can spend as much time as they want in the Submarine and the timeline is an average time spent inside.
6
King Kamehameha Statue
Statue of the King who unified the Hawaiian Islands in Downtown Honolulu that was featured in Hawai`i Five-0. Guests can choose from a photo stop or a walking tour of the area. The timeline reflects a photo stop at the statue.
7
Iolani Palace
Headquarters of the Hawaiian Kingdom across from the Kamehameha Statue. Guests can view the palace from the statue, take a walking tour of the grounds outside the palace, or do one of the guided or audio set tour inside the palace. Timeline reflects the average time of a walking tour.
8
Nu’uanu Pali
Guests can add a stop at the famous Nu`uanu Pali Lookout for a great scenic view of Windward O`ahu.
9
Aloha Stadium Swap Meet & Marketplace
Guests have the option to add the Aloha Stadium Swap Meet to the tour on Wednesday, most Saturdays and Sundays. Guests can spend as much time as they like here and the timeline is an average.
10
Diamond Head State Monument
Guests can hike to the top or view from scenic lookout at the base. Timeline is for the hike.
11
Waikele Premium Outlets
Guests can choose to shop at WPO and spend as much time as they like there. The timeline below is an average time spent at the Outlets.
12
Bishop Museum
Learn more about Hawai`i and Oceania at the Bishop Museum. Great for both kids and adults and guests can even request a behind the scenes tour. The timeline reflects the minimum recommended time in the museum.
13
Waikiki
Guests not staying in Waikīkī can add time exploring this world famous resort destination. Enjoy great food, cocktails, entertainment and so much more. Guests can spend as much or as little time in town as they want and the timeline reflects the average.
14
Waikiki Beach
Guests not staying in Waikīkī can experience the world famous beach and even take a surf lesson, canoe ride, or just lounge under the view of Diamond Head. Surf lessons and Canoe Rides should be reserved in advance with one of the beach boy companies. Guests can spend as much or as little time in town as they want and the timeline reflects the average.
15
National Memorial Cemetery of the Pacific
Guests can drive through the “Arlington of the Pacific” and pay tribute to those who have sacrificed their lives for freedom. This visit is a drive through only, however if you have a family member in the cemetery please reach out to us in advance.
16
Tantalus Lookout Puu Ualakaa State Park
Guests can enjoy a breathtaking scenic view and drive above Honolulu. See the lookout featured in "Blue Hawai`i" with Elvis Presley. The timeline accounts for drive to and from with a photo stop.
